💡
原文英文,约3500词,阅读约需13分钟。
📝
内容提要
移动测试自动化通过工具和框架模拟用户交互,评估功能并早期发现问题,提升测试效率和准确性,支持持续集成与交付。尽管面临设备碎片化和操作系统差异等挑战,结构化的自动化方法能够有效管理资源,改善用户体验。
🎯
关键要点
- 移动测试自动化使用工具和框架自动测试移动应用程序,模拟用户交互以评估功能并早期发现问题。
- 自动化测试加快了测试过程,提高了准确性,并支持持续集成和交付。
- 移动测试面临设备碎片化、操作系统差异和网络条件等挑战,需要结构化的自动化方法来有效管理资源。
- 移动测试自动化的主要优点包括更快的测试执行、更好的准确性、更广泛的测试覆盖和成本效益。
- 移动应用测试自动化适用于多种场景,包括不同设备和操作系统的兼容性测试、UI交互测试和性能测试。
- 选择自动化工具时需考虑支持多平台测试、提高覆盖率、24/7运行测试和易于使用等因素。
- 实施自动化测试的步骤包括规划测试策略、设置测试环境、编写测试脚本、运行测试和分析结果。
- 移动测试自动化面临的挑战包括设备和操作系统的多样性、网络问题、测试脚本维护和CI/CD集成。
- 未来的移动测试自动化趋势包括云测试、5G测试、低代码和无代码自动化、AI驱动的测试和自愈测试脚本。
- 保持对AI工具和云解决方案的更新将使测试过程保持未来准备状态。
❓
延伸问答
移动测试自动化的主要优点是什么?
移动测试自动化的主要优点包括更快的测试执行、更好的准确性、更广泛的测试覆盖和成本效益。
实施移动测试自动化的步骤有哪些?
实施移动测试自动化的步骤包括规划测试策略、设置测试环境、编写测试脚本、运行测试和分析结果。
移动测试自动化面临哪些挑战?
移动测试自动化面临的挑战包括设备碎片化、操作系统差异、网络问题和测试脚本维护等。
选择移动测试自动化工具时应考虑哪些因素?
选择自动化工具时需考虑支持多平台测试、提高覆盖率、24/7运行测试和易于使用等因素。
移动测试自动化适用于哪些场景?
移动测试自动化适用于不同设备和操作系统的兼容性测试、UI交互测试、性能测试等多种场景。
未来移动测试自动化的趋势是什么?
未来的移动测试自动化趋势包括云测试、5G测试、低代码和无代码自动化、AI驱动的测试和自愈测试脚本。
➡️